Have you heard the news? The Dutch government had to halt electronic access to critical government services because their certificate authority, DigiNotar, was compromised. What will you do if your CA is next? How long can you afford to be down?

With DigiNotar joining the ranks of Comodo, StartSSL and RSA as the latest, hacked trusted third-parties, enterprises and government agencies need to realize that SSL must be properly managed and begin formulating PKI disaster recovery and business continuity plans.

Organizations must have an actionable and comprehensive plan in place to recover from a CA compromise, where the time to restore critical services should be measured in hours. Due to lack of preparation and largely manual processes, recovery for most organizations will take days or weeks while the thousands or tens of thousands of compromised SSL certificates are manually located, accounted for and replaced.

There are very specific steps organizations must take to deal with a compromised CA.
